Eryani visits MBS Hospital in Aden, hails its services
[01/05/2024 04:38]
ADEN - SABA
Minister of Information Muammar al-Eryani has paid a visit to Prince Mohammed bin Salman Hospital in the temporary capital, Aden and toured the hospital's departments, including its cardiac center and specialized clinics.
Al-Eryani was briefed by the hospital's staff on the services the hospital has offered since it was rehabilitated, equipped, and operated by the Saudi Development and Reconstruction Program for Yemen.
He hailed the services the hospital to Yemeni citizens from all parts of the country through 14 specialized clinics with a clinical capacity of 272 beds.
